The KFC Mauritius Marathon 2026 will take place on July 5, 2026 in Saint-Félix.

The essentials in a few words

The KFC Mauritius Marathon 2026 will take place on July 5, 2026, in Saint-Félix, featuring four road races: a 5km Fun Race open to runners aged 8 and up, a 10km race for those aged 15 and up, a 21.1km half marathon, and a full marathon of 42.195km, the latter two being reserved for runners aged 18 and over. All races start and finish on the public beach of Saint-Félix. The course follows the southwest coast, with its turquoise lagoon on one side and the inland mountain range on the other, passing through some more exposed sections where the reef comes close to the shore, particularly near Maconde and Baie du Cap. The event is open to international runners, and registration is online. The atmosphere is family-friendly and festive, the course is flat, and the timing coincides with the southern winter, ideal for running in mild temperatures.

Far from the major events on the Mauritian tourism calendar, the KFC Mauritius Marathon It's a rather exclusive event held annually in the south of the island, in the heart of the southern winter. A race certified by the international federations AIMS and IAAF, it mainly attracts international runners and a loyal local community, but remains largely untouched by mainstream media coverage. Many visitors staying in Mauritius in July never even hear about it.

For those who cross the starting line, it's a course of rare beauty: a road that hugs the southwest coast, alternating between turquoise lagoons and more exposed sections like Maconde, with the silhouette of Le Morne Brabant standing out on the horizon for much of the race. The 2026 edition will be held on Sunday, July 5, 2026 starting from the public beach of Saint-Félixin the Savanne district. Four distances are offered, from the 5 km family run to the full marathon of 42.195 km, allowing everyone to find their race, whether they are a visitor passing through or a resident who has come with their family.

Four races for all levels

The organizers are offering four distances on the same morning, with staggered starts from the public beach in Saint-Félix. The schedule is designed so that marathon runners start first, in the cooler morning air, followed by those running shorter distances.

Marathon — 42.195 km

The race has started 6:30 AMThe registration fee is 1,900 Mauritian rupeesThe race would be open to runners aged 18 and over, with a cut-off time of 6 hours. It's the classic distance, the one that takes runners to the foot of the Morne Brabant before returning to Saint-Félix.

Half marathon — 21.1 km

Departure at 7:00 AM, registration at 1,500 rupeesOpen to those 18 and over, with a 4-hour cut-off time. The course extends to Cape Anbalaba Bay before turning back. It's a distance accessible to prepared runners without requiring the physical exertion of a full marathon.

10 km

Departure at 7:30 a.m., registration at 1,250 rupees, from age 15. The route joins the coastal road of Beautiful Shadow and comes back. A good option for regular runners who want to participate without a specific training plan.

Fun Race — 5 km

Departure at 8:00 AM, registration at 600 rupeesSuitable for ages 8 and up. This is a family race, which can be completed by running or walking. Ideal for getting children and accompanying adults who aren't experienced runners involved.

Route and landscapes traversed

The marathon route crosses one of the most beautiful coastlines in Mauritius. Starting in Saint-Félix, runners head west along Riambel, where there is a first turnaround point after 4 km. They then continue west to the village of Le Morne, the second turnaround point located at 25.1 km. The return journey follows the same route back to the finish line in Saint-Félix.

For most of its length, the road runs alongside a lagoon protected by the coral reef, whose turquoise color contrasts with the deep blue of the open sea. A few more spectacular sections break this regularity, particularly around the Maconde Viewpoint and of the Cape Baywhere the reef comes very close to the coast and the waves crash directly against the basalt cliffs. Morne BrabantThe mountain,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, serves as a visual landmark for much of the race. The landscapes alternate between sugarcane fields, coastal villages, southwestern hotels, and deserted beaches.

The course is generally flat, making it suitable for personal bests. The surface is asphalt, and road traffic is controlled during the morning.

How to register

Registration is done online via the platform ROAGROAG, which manages the administration of sporting events in Mauritius, requires the usual information: identity, chosen distance, t-shirt size, and emergency contact. A free ROAG account is required to complete registration and payment.

The registration deadline would be set at June 17, 2026However, places are limited, and the organizers indicate that registration may close before this date if the quota is reached. It is therefore recommended to register as early as possible, especially for international runners who also need to arrange their travel and accommodation. To stay up-to-date on event news and last-minute announcements, the official Facebook page is regularly updated.

No shuttle service is provided by the organizers: runners must arrange their own transportation to Saint-Félix on the morning of the race. It is recommended to arrive at least one hour before the start to collect your race number and drop off your belongings.

Practical information for visiting runners

For foreign runners making the trip, a few organizational points deserve to be anticipated.

When to come and how long to stay

Since the marathon takes place on a Sunday morning, the ideal time to arrive is in Mauritius. at least three or four days before The race, time to recover from jet lag, acclimatize, and perhaps familiarize yourself with part of the course. The climate in July

July corresponds to the southern winter in Mauritius. Temperatures are significantly cooler than during the summer: between 17 and 25°C on average along the coast, sometimes slightly cooler early in the morning in the windier south. Rainfall is low and humidity remains moderate. These conditions are particularly favorable for long-distance running, without the oppressive heat typical of tropical marathons.

The morning of the race

As temperatures can be cool at sunrise, it's advisable to bring an extra layer before setting off. A visor or cap, sunglasses, and sunscreen are essential, as the sun rises quickly after 8 a.m. As is common throughout Mauritius, tap water is not always safe to drink in all areas: bring bottled water before and after the race.

Watching the marathon without running

If your spouse, children, or friends are running, there are several options for following the race without participating. The public beach in Saint-Félix is the best vantage point: it's where the start, finish, and entertainment are concentrated. The atmosphere is friendly, with music, refreshments, and cheers from local spectators—without the crowds of major international marathons.

To watch the runners in action, several points along the coastal road between Saint-Félix and Bel Ombre offer excellent vantage points, provided you reach them before the road closes. For those following a marathoner to the turnaround point, the village of Le Morne (25.1 km from the start) is a symbolic spot to cheer them on during the toughest part of the race.

Frequently Asked Questions

When will the KFC Mauritius Marathon 2026 take place?

Sunday, July 5, 2026, starting from the public beach of Saint-Félix, in the district of Savanne.

What distances are offered?

Four distances: 5 km Fun Race, 10 km, 21.1 km half marathon and 42.195 km full marathon. All starts take place on the same morning in Saint-Félix.

How much does registration cost?

600 rupees for the 5km, 1,250 rupees for the 10km, 1,500 rupees for the half marathon, and 1,900 rupees for the marathon. These prices are indicative and subject to confirmation upon registration on the official platform.

Until when can we register?

The registration deadline is set for June 17, 2026, but as places are limited, early registration is recommended.

Is there a minimum age to participate?

Yes: 8 years for the 5km, 15 years for the 10km, 18 years for the half-marathon and the marathon.

What are the time limits for finishing the race?

Six hours for the marathon and four hours for the half-marathon. No official cut-off time is mentioned for the 10km and 5km races.

Is the event open to foreign runners?

Yes, registration is open to everyone, regardless of nationality. No specific documents are required in addition to the ROAG registration form, but a recent medical certificate may be recommended for long distances.

Are there shuttle buses to get to the starting point?

No, no shuttle service is provided. Runners must arrange their own transportation to Saint-Félix.

What is the weather like in Mauritius in July?

July is one of the coolest months of the year in Mauritius. Temperatures generally range between 17 and 25°C during the day, with little rain. These are ideal conditions for running.

Should I train differently for this marathon?

The course is flat and the climate mild, making it more accessible than many marathons. Standard training is still essential for the 42km and 21km races, ideally including some runs in moderate heat to acclimatize to tropical conditions.
